there really isnt anything for the 7mge, its really about hard work stuff like porting and polishing the head getting an exhaust header boring out the engine, and getting a computer piggyback so you can delete the accused MAF sensor, replacing your 2 piece drive line to a 1 piece aluminum, getting a FULL 2.5 inch exhaust.. and even after all of this your only gonna make maybe 205 to the wheels.

just convert the 7m-ge to the NA-t and itll be alot cheaper and much more worth it.

Yea just buy a used turbo manifold and CT26 for cheap from a gte along with a intercooler and down pipe run some oil lines and run about 8psi-10psi and make 250-280whp

Make sure your Motor is in Good shape.

Headers and exhaust make a good difference, a shift kit if auto also helps a bit. Also ensure the engine is in tune and everything works.
The GE is far more friendly in the day to day real world, much more off the line performance and no annoying lag when trying to keep up with traffic. The GE is still an impressive engine, 200 hp out of a 3 litre six is still significant and the broad, flat torque curve also helps make them an excellent engine to live with day to day.
If you had ready access to E85, a 13 to 1 compression build would yield a nice engine.
